Poi Info

  • Other Info: Lowest point of the Dix 'Finger Slides' and parallels Dix Trail. Easily traversed with hiking footwear. 3-season hikers should exit the slide before the scree section that leads to the Thumb or Index Slides due to steepness of both the slides and the Dix
